Curriculum Vitae

 

I was born on April 26th 1969 in Yerseke, the Netherlands. From an early age on I was interested in chemistry. Therefore after finishing high school, I completed successfully a study analytical chemistry at the HZ University for Applied Sciences.

 

After graduation I started my career at the Netherlands Institute for Ecology in the department of Marine Microbiology. From that moment on an even more challenging and interesting field of research revealed to me: the link between biology and ecology on the one hand and chemistry on the other hand.

 

My first research involved the speciation of trace metals in relation to algae using techniques as polarograpy and chromatography. In the years following I extended my work on planktonic and bentic diatoms, mainly focused on the influence of oxidative stress.

 

In 1995 I got the opportunity to study the carbon balance of salt marshes by using stable isotopes as a tracer. This was my first introduction to the powerful world of stable isotopes.

 

 Shortly after that another challenge was offered to me: I got involved in a project to study the impact of UV-B radiation on the photosynthesis and biochemistry of terrestrial vegetation in the Antarctic. This was an excellent opportunity to combine two of my passions: science and traveling. Four summer seasons (1996-2001) I was stationed on Rothera base (67° 34’ S, 68 ° 08’ W) on the Antarctic Peninsula. Rothera is the principal British Antarctic Survey logistics centre for support of Antarctic field science with whom this project was joined. During four to five months a year I could spend my time solving some of the unsolved questions of the Antarctic mysteries. To compare the outcome of the results of the Antarctic region a proposal was granted to work in the Arctic region for one summer at a research base at Ny-Ålesund. Ny-Ålesund is situated at 78° 55´ N, 11° 56´ E on the west coast of Spitsbergen, the largest island in the Svalbard archipelago.

 

After the Antarctic project was finished I joined in 2005 the NWO-VIDI project ‘Linking microbial community structure and biogeochemical functioning in coastal marine sediments’ Methods applied were based on stable isotope (13C) labelling and biomarker analysis as lipids. A new available technique was introduced: high-performance liquid chromatography isotope ratio mass spectrometry (LC/IRMS). Being one of the first users in the world an unexplored area was waiting to be discovered. We developed a method to analyse 13C carbohydrates using this technique.

 

Recently I started to work on my PhD to expand the possibilities of the new LC/IRMS technique and to apply it in the marine microbial research to get a better understanding of the ecology of micro organisms and the role that micro organisms play in biogeochemical cycles.
